New Jersey State Opera Celebrates the Legacy of Alfredo Silipigni in Free Memorial Tribute Concert

Monday, June 12, 2006, 7:30 PM in Prudential Hall, NJPAC, Newark, NJ

 

 

Alfredo Silipigni:

His Vision and His Music  

A Memorial Tribute Concert

7:30 pm

Prudential Hall at New Jersey Performing Arts Center, Newark, NJ

Open to the Public without charge

 

A free concert in celebration of the life and legacy of Alfredo Silipigni, commemorating his forty years as Artistic Director and Principal Conductor  of the New Jersey State Opera. Featuring the New Jersey State Opera Orchestra and Chorus with Invited Soloists and Guests. Conducted by Joseph Colaneri, member of the conducting roster of the Metropolitan Opera and Artistic Director of the Mannes Opera at Mannes College of Music in New York City, with Jason Tramm as Chorus Master.  Musical selections will include works by Mascagni, Puccini and Verdi.
